Position Overview
Manages the development and implementation of program quality plans, programs, and procedures using statistical quality control statistics, Lean Manufacturing concepts and Six-Sigma tools and analysis.
Essential Functions
- Lead the Quality Management System (QMS Management Representative)
- Manage various customer programs, involving customer interface, monitoring and timely completion of customer requirements
- Makes sure quality discrepancies related to assembly, process, mechanical, electrical and electro-mechanical systems are reviewed, analyzed and reported
- Directs investigations or problems and develops disposition and corrective actions for recurring discrepancies
- Oversees the Quality interfaces with manufacturing, engineering, customer, vendor and subcontractor representatives to ensure requirements are met
- Covers supplier quality actions relative to products and services provided that includes onsite auditing, troubleshooting and corrective actions
- Develops and monitors metrics relative to escapes, delivered quality, scrap, rework and repair and business operation results
- Investigates to determine root cause, corrective and preventive action utilizing continuous improvement tools
- Supports continuous improvement processes and initiatives for functional areas of responsibility
- Maintains databases and mines information to have real-time and accurate reports measuring goal accomplishments
- Develops/maintains performance metrics and manages to highest efficiency (e.g., POI Dwell, NC’s, etc.)
- Ensures Internal audit program is effective
- Manages external audits by customers, regulatory agencies and certification bodies
Qualifications
- Ability to set priorities, meet deadlines, and multitask
- Excellent delegation and organizational skills with strong attention to detail
- Excellent skills in written and oral communication and teamwork
- Work independently and possess a high level of self-motivation and initiative
- Effectively problem solve, prioritize, and follow through on assignments and projects
- AS9100, ISO 13485, FAA, and FDA Quality Systems experience, as applicable
- Proven FAA PMA and/or Part 21, 121, 145 Repair Station experience
- Ability to use micrometers, calipers, gauges, fixtures, optical comparator, and hardness testers
- Experience in driving continuous improvement processes such as through Six Sigma, Green Belt or higher certifications
- Authority to manage personnel and processes related to administrative controls, business needs, and company goals
